Hello all,
I have searched and searched but can't figure out what this turbo is.
The part number on it is: 466608-9002
It is a Garrett 400 series, supposedly comes on John Deere 6466 equipment.
But there are no A/r numbers i can see, does anyone have any more info or ideas where I can look? T4, T3, etc..
Thanks,
Mike

HMMMM,
Pretty sure its a T4, been a while since I looked at one, and depending on hp rating could be bigger than that, they were used on 126hp 6404t (older little brother) - 258hp 6466ta in that engine family.
I'd love to put one of them in a P/U, love how they sound when they spool up (screw a cummins). Anyway let me see if I can find out anything.

Went and looked at a few but really didn't find out much, 2 on combines a 404 and a 466 only thing I could still read or see was schwitzer hmmm
, and 2 tractors one had a 6619ta had a garrett and a 6404t had a garrett, on the compressor housing it had AirResearch T04 but thats all I could see, but I know I saw an A/R on that turbo when I rebuilt that engine but its been 8 years, original 1974 turbo still going strong 18,000+ hours, I believe it pushed around 30 psi @rated 126hp @2100rpm.
Wish I could be more help but I'm turbo illiterate
, wish I had my tech manuals at the house, if I think about it I'll try to look and see if they say anything.

At work today' I saw another garrett 6466t 120hp or so tractor, the compressor housing had A/R .60 and also 40mm on it. Sorry no exhaust #. Wish I still worked around them more, I now work on hmmwv's for the Gov. rebuilding them
.
. 466608-9002S TB4129 John Deere RN16969
Frame size = TB4129
John Deere part # = RN16969
A/R's of .84 ,1.00 and 1.15 for the 466608 part #.
Maybe that will help get you started.
You might swing by john deere and get them to run that number for you.
